Get ready to be swept away by the turbulent waves of love, passion, and resilience as the Soap Opera Deep In Love returns to our screens. This captivating series tells the story of a strong-willed woman and a passionate man, both battling their own storms, set against the backdrop of the fierce Black Sea.

What to Expect

In this 24-episode first season, viewers will be taken on an emotional journey, exploring the depths of the human soul, the ups and downs of life’s mountains, and the relentless power of the sea. Through the eyes of a stranger caught in the midst of a centuries-old feud between two sworn enemies, Deep In Love promises to deliver a narrative that is both poignant and gripping.
